A picturesque walking trail, located in Cedar Breaks National Monument, leads to a surreal alpine pond. Perfect in the summer to view wildlife and wildflowers. Early in the season this trail may have drifts of snow or be muddy.

This loop trail forms a figure-eight through forest and meadows. There are multiple ways to experience this trail. Starting at the trailhead, you can start on the lower trail for excellent views of the amphitheater or the upper trail for views of meadows of native wildflowers, spruce-fir-aspen forest, and ancient deposits of volcanic materials. The lower trail also leads to Alpine Pond, just after the pond, you may choose to take the cut-off connecting to the upper trail to return to the trailhead (one-mile round trip option) or continue on the lower trail till it connects with the upper trail and then return to the trailhead (two-miles round trip option).

Trailhead location: Chessman Ridge Overlook in Cedar Breaks on Hwy 148
